How did you get rid of the old decals on the Merc cowling before adding the new ones? Looks clean.![]()
</td></tr></table>
Its alot of work to make it look right, You have to pull the stock decals off with a hair dryer and believe me they are on there..After you get that all done then you have to prep and clean everything with a compound that take forever then a couple of coats of wax..Then get the decals made by the lizard man and measure and measure some more to get them right, clean the cowl with some rubbing alcohol and put the stickers on nice and slow and work out all the air bubbles..It take a while i am not going to lie and its not perfect but i like it better then the old stickers..![]()
